Introduction to MarkdownMind:
Markdown is a lightweight markup language that allows users to format their documents without requiring complex HTML tags or the use of graphical interfaces. It leverages a combination of symbols, such as asterisks, underscores, and hashtags, to highlight text styles, create headings, emphasize words, and integrate images and links within the content. The simplicity and readability of Markdown make it particularly valuable for creating documents that can be read across multiple platforms without formatting loss, and for projects requiring quick drafts or collaborative editing.

Enhanced Markdown Editors:
To fully benefit from the power of MarkdownMind, users often turn to enhanced Markdown editors, which provide advanced editing tools and features that augment the basic capabilities of Markdown. These editors may include real-time previewing, advanced formatting options, and intuitive tools for organizing and structuring content. Some key features that elevate the editing experience in enhanced Markdown editors include:

2. Enhanced Image Support: Apart from basic inline image insertion, advanced tools often support features like image thumbnails, tooltips, and lazy loading, optimizing both the initial loading time and the overall user experience on websites or blogs.

3. Code Block Customization: To handle code within a document, Markdown supports the inclusion of indented or fenced code blocks. Enhanced editors provide better formatting options for these regions, such as changing syntax highlighting color schemes, wrapping code blocks in proper HTML tags, and even direct GitHub-style syntax highlighting, which can significantly improve code readability and debugging capabilities.

4. List Management: Enhanced Markdown editors provide more intuitive ways to handle lists, from easy toggling between ordered and unordered lists to improved list merging and sub-list creation. These tools make organizing notes or cataloging information more straightforward.

5. Document Navigation and Organization: Features like table of contents generation, cross-referencing, and bookmarking tools enhance the accessibility and navigational ease of MarkdownMind. They facilitate quicker document discovery and provide an outline view of the document’s structure, making long-form content easier to manage and review.

6. Collaborative Features: For group projects, enhanced Markdown editors offer real-time collaboration, with functions like text suggestions, inline comments, and version control. This enables multiple users to edit the same document simultaneously, streamlining the review and feedback process.

7. Format Conversion Tools: Beyond Markdown, these editors provide effortless conversion support for other formats (e.g., LaTeX, HTML, plain text, PDF, etc.), as well as exporting directly to platforms like Google Docs for sharing and collaboration.
